    Hi everyone.  I think I posted here earlier in the year.   I am winding down on my every 3 weeks of Herceptin only. If I calculate right, only 7  more to go...   the end of September.   

    If  you are getting A/C, you will pee red for a day or so.  Drink LOTS of water or juice to flush your system and keep hydrated.  And after my A/C I got a neulasta shot within 48 hours for red blood cells.   And take Emend and zofan for nausea.  It made me queasy, and I ate very small amounts of food often - like grazing as I passed the fridge.  Soft foods and cold foods tasted best.  

    I was off herceptin for about 6 weeks after Taxol and Herceptin and lumpectomy and the neuropathy went away completely.  You cannot tell me that Herceptin did/does not cause it, as I have it since I started H only in January.   And after each treatment, I take 2 tylenol with codeine the first night so I can get to sleep - bone aches.   Off and on my bones ache but not all the time.I notice that I am more tired, fatigued with each treatment.     

    The only shoes that are comfortable are crocs or open back slip ons.   If my toes nails ever grow back completely, I will be in sandals but for now, they are too ugly to expose to others.

    Had my third Herceptin Monday.  Had a bad reaction, warm, tingle, and numbness throughout body, face, neck and head.  Throat became swollen.  Like an allegic reaction from bee sting/peanut allergies.  The Herceptin was almost done.  They stopped it right away and gave me Benodryl, tagamet, dexamethasone to counter-act it.  Got severe chills so they then gave me demoral for that.  Has this happened to anyone else?  They want me to try again Monday, giving me all the pre-meds first.  When the meds wore off the allergic reation happened again and I went to the ER.  They loaded me up some more and sent me home after about 4 hours.

    Took meds yesterday also to prevent reaction.  Doing good today, but scared to go through it again.
